DonutCrystal2.zip is a high-performance Minecraft resource pack specifically engineered for Crystal PvP (CPvP). It is widely recognized within the competitive community for its optimization and visual clarity, often associated with the popular DonutSMP server and content creator DrDonut. Core Features of DonutCrystal2.zip

Unlike standard texture packs that prioritize aesthetic realism, DonutCrystal2.zip is an "engineering effort" focused on competitive advantages.

FPS Optimization: The pack minimizes visual noise and simplifies textures (such as netherite armor and swords) to maximize Frames Per Second (FPS) efficiency, which is critical for low-latency combat. Visual Clarity for Combat:

Small Totem Pops: Reduces screen-blocking animations when a Totem of Undying is used.

Low Fire: Significantly lowers the fire overlay so players can see clearly even when burning.

Reduced Explosions: Clears up screen clutter caused by End Crystal, bed, or anchor explosions.

Hitbox and Border Cues: The pack often includes subtle, transparent borders that appear when holding items like End Crystals or Obsidian, helping players judge placement and hitboxes more accurately.

Blue-Themed GUI: Many versions feature a clean, blue-themed interface designed to match the branding of DrDonut. Context and Usage

The pack is a staple for players on DonutSMP (IP: donutsmp.net), an anarchy-lite survival server where Crystal PvP is the dominant fighting style. It is frequently used in conjunction with the DonutSMP Crystal Optimizer, a client-side mod that prevents dangerous or useless clicks during combat to reduce lag and accidental deaths. How to Install

Download: Obtain the .zip file from authorized community links like Modrinth or specific creator Discord servers.

Locate Minecraft Folder: Open Minecraft and navigate to Options > Resource Packs > Open Pack Folder.

Move the File: Drag the DonutCrystal2.zip file into the folder.

Activate: Return to the game, find the pack in the "Available" list, and move it to the "Selected" column.
